Hi,
I have a Galaxy Nexus with unrooted stock Android 4.3 (build JWR66Y) and I am experiencing a weird behavior with stock launcher since I have updated to Android 4.3.
It happens when I uninstall any app that is organized within a folder in the home screen, thus the removed app icon remains in that folder, and when I try to open that folder the stock launcher force closes. I mean, every time that I do the steps described bellow the stock launcher force closes:
1)Uninstall an app that is within a folder at home screen;
2)Although the app is removed, its icon still remains within its home screen folder;
3) Then, When I try to open the removed app folder the stock launcher always force closes...
I was just wondering if is it a known bug for Android 4.3? Is someone else experiencing the same issue?Is there any workaround for this issue?
I have searched about It and I couldn't find any help...
Thanks

Experienced the same issue here. Only fix for me was to install a different launcher (nova for me) and that didn't fc, also was a lot faster imo because when I pressed the home button, the stock launcher first had a coffee before showing me my homescreen.
